Output c63eebb31990aaf35bf7edd6d712ff8191dadcfc1727540dfe5f892acd5cde2e:0

value
1849659
script pubkey
OP_0 OP_PUSHBYTES_20 8c2abcd9d12f37e51355107a2b98ca0fd2a8dd3a
address
bc1q3s4tekw39um72y64zpazhxx2plf23hf6j6rx58
transaction
c63eebb31990aaf35bf7edd6d712ff8191dadcfc1727540dfe5f892acd5cde2e
confirmations
1474
spent
false